Advanced Certificate in Risk Management

The Advanced Certificate in Risk Management is a 15-credit graduate program designed to develop foundational skills in the critical functions necessary for success in risk management. The advanced certificate program will sharpen your skills in planning, forecasting, decision-making, and implementation through case studies and hands-on exercises.

You will gain perspectives on contemporary risk management theory and practice from a distinguished faculty comprising professors from St. John’s University’s Tobin College of Business; its School of Risk Management, Insurance and Actuarial Science; and business professionals and experts. 

All courses are offered during evenings and weekends. Additionally, our program offers the following benefits:

  • Evenings and weekend classes are offered at our Queens or Manhattan campuses, or online, allowing you to stay on your career track and complete the program in two years.
  • Continuation of studies possible, seamlessly leading into our Master of Science (M.S.) in Enterprise Risk Management, our M.S. in Risk Management and Risk Analytics
  • Admission considerations based on work experience, veteran status and academic background
  • Ability to transfer up to six (6) credits of prior coursework towards the program.

Courses

The Advanced Certificate in Risk Management program will require two courses and three elective risk management-related courses (9 credits) from the offerings of the Tobin College.  The two required courses are as follows:

  • ERM 601 Foundations of Enterprise Risk Management
  • RMI 601 Risk Management

This advanced certificate program also requires three courses (9 credits) from any risk management-related course offered by the Tobin College of Business.  Students must successfully complete all five courses within a three-year period.

Admissions

Application Requirements
All applicants must possess a baccalaureate degree from an accredited institution or the international equivalent prior to enrollment at the graduate level. In addition to the application form and non-refundable application fee candidates should submit the following:

  • Statement of professional goals and resume, which can be uploaded as part of the  application for admission
  • Official transcripts from all undergraduate, graduate, and professional schools attended.
  • One letter of recommendation, obtained from professional or academic references
  • Official TOEFL or IELTS scores are required for applicants whose native language is not English
  • Students with international credits must also submit a course-by-course foreign credit evaluation with GPA calculation from a NACES member
